IBM BladeCenter T
The BladeCenter T chassis ships
standard with one Advanced
Management Module.
In contrast to the standard BladeCenter
chassis, the KVM module and the
Management Module in the
BladeCenter T chassis are separate
components. The front of the
Management Module only features the
LEDs for displaying status. All Ethernet
and KVM connections are fed through
to the rear to the LAN and KVM
modules.
The KVM module is a hot swap module
at the rear of the chassis providing two
PS/2 connectors for keyboard and
mouse, a systems-status panel, and a
HD-15 video connector.

IBM BladeCenter HT
The BladeCenter HT chassis ships
standard with one Advanced
Management Module. This module
provides the ability to manage the
chassis as well as providing the local
KVM function.

Note: In order to support Auto-discovery, IBM BladeCenter Models H and
E must use AMM with firmware version BPET36K or later.
Note: In the case of IBM Blade Center Models E and H, the KSX II only
supports auto-discovery for AMM[1] as the acting primary management
module.
